summ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orPacho Ramos <pacho@gentoo.org>2012-12-25 14:33:52 +0000
committerPacho Ramos <pacho@gentoo.org>2012-12-25 14:33:52 +0000
commit1b3e265474ef0760a54d699d6f61f43abcfd990a (patch)
tree376ca12e70f50f4a66686c2602e9c129b237fba9 /www-apps/viewvc
parentDrop versions needing deprecated gmime:0 (diff)
downloadhistorical-1b3e265474ef0760a54d699d6f61f43abcfd990a.tar.gz
historical-1b3e265474ef0760a54d699d6f61f43abcfd990a.tar.bz2
historical-1b3e265474ef0760a54d699d6f61f43abcfd990a.zip
Drop mod_python support due its treecleaning (#343663), drop old.
Package-Manager: portage-2.1.11.38/cvs/Linux x86_64 Manifest-Sign-Key: 0xA188FBD4
Diffstat (limited to 'www-apps/viewvc')
-rw-r--r--www-apps/viewvc/ChangeLog6
-rw-r--r--www-apps/viewvc/Manifest14
-rw-r--r--www-apps/viewvc/metadata.xml1
-rw-r--r--www-apps/viewvc/viewvc-1.1.13.ebuild118
-rw-r--r--www-apps/viewvc/viewvc-1.1.17.ebuild25
5 files changed, 18 insertions, 146 deletions
diff --git a/www-apps/viewvc/ChangeLog b/www-apps/viewvc/ChangeLog
index b92ecfa0f032..311ba43d150e 100644
--- a/www-apps/viewvc/ChangeLog
+++ b/www-apps/viewvc/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for www-apps/viewvc
# Copyright 1999-2012 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/www-apps/viewvc/ChangeLog,v 1.88 2012/11/12 18:46:50 nativemad Exp $
+# $Header: /var/cvsroot/gentoo-x86/www-apps/viewvc/ChangeLog,v 1.89 2012/12/25 14:33:47 pacho Exp $
+
+ 25 Dec 2012; Pacho Ramos <pacho@gentoo.org> -viewvc-1.1.13.ebuild,
+ metadata.xml, viewvc-1.1.17.ebuild:
+ Drop mod_python support due its treecleaning (#343663), drop old.
13 Nov 2012; Andreas Schuerch <nativemad@gentoo.org> viewvc-1.1.17.ebuild:
x86 stable, see bug 440774
diff --git a/www-apps/viewvc/Manifest b/www-apps/viewvc/Manifest
index 20ce0dbf198b..22e05cd3ad39 100644
--- a/www-apps/viewvc/Manifest
+++ b/www-apps/viewvc/Manifest
@@ -1,16 +1,14 @@
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256
-DIST viewvc-1.1.13.tar.gz 607965 SHA256 29b946a296bf59f685d892460fa0da639884dd5911ab5bce8c2afc7b2aea47a8
DIST viewvc-1.1.17.tar.gz 611890 SHA256 3fec2c56bdea6529870e544e3e87fe4e0e1d4eafa42a468723ef2a35eaa607a6 SHA512 f8fdc7aea638d54a9bb7b336404b20df5d83cdce866b446ec418a2557be6470584bbf4a90031a5d5521328b1f7bd17e087060edd62c849c0a886a89081b35df9 WHIRLPOOL 91df84ca4be369107f3790c0f091a1fdd96efd452a46bc4ba1bc97265db18b913af674fa507902309a8e3031be26d04ec59d4363afefc582cfa6b11936a92666
-EBUILD viewvc-1.1.13.ebuild 3070 SHA256 3896a2275c7da48d9837b971e2d24a437a01ef85c5ee1823fa194e6d231673ef SHA512 ddc5a208e992dbce4c01e414f33efa9a561eccc29a7ceecd149dc3bc96cc5397f2c651f2e00aa308818f0faa495794652cfb544533b3e3f6169dab26437016a9 WHIRLPOOL 05320c5e9c4da3e29dfd94cd6b2b4cefe270daa7a9977288a2f2ba4adf17531de4b62399f3a8b1f824b1ce6ed1d321490b18aa649082c56dfd124c88a169c202
-EBUILD viewvc-1.1.17.ebuild 3071 SHA256 0598cc8c0f8d9a20fb71f23f0903b7b3f8a9b5e652c0b0b8cae2f8eb4ffd88be SHA512 00525b6d061b6e236dd43003eb34937a61b5965de037f5838ab91011de55b346e87bc87e074824792944db89d894c0c222b27b9f215f653952b1a88a4c0f0219 WHIRLPOOL 5f09584e8cf8e9d39fdd705a679831dd1c2860f8c09e91ee920f11b5f5d3c7642285eb528ad157944abe1ed400dc3e4add6dc87dc361e08ef017099065e2c4fe
-MISC ChangeLog 11309 SHA256 f7a30421243d4c5b21f97cc27a8008d7dac48f8f087102a5a056f45e642b55c0 SHA512 c24916e6fa4f59006d9a35325b035bd09bd4a2ec5a285d31da5b2635285bd288e9a735007370eb4b30e108bb45cf565b9d36a24a3536cb5d439b969f2d5adb12 WHIRLPOOL d48f7c6e0c6785cc305edece93f7db8d64ecc0c5b47d48946e125c477ceeabab6f16b7f64d770a831ab0bf8062f20920296536a810b180aef240806244135a83
-MISC metadata.xml 548 SHA256 6a19b8afa2e811ee5e525127ef3a562e7085167e43df792ba171772516b44540 SHA512 5c85c6949a74d40d927611ce54cb59bf862e275fdf8b6df8ee110a5b7a51a9154f32197f3d37a58d32e0450cdea4baadf0c615703683612d25bd1387fcc90743 WHIRLPOOL 1ce8f03ff5fefbf77b9ab60214d71903cb9569e810d3a5d2065abe83a76a4e2dcbbc67140c6d262996826d9c48f1bdcbf02b64cd9d49a90897b43a4c1670917a
+EBUILD viewvc-1.1.17.ebuild 2685 SHA256 dbe2391da74201783811f1f2bca92bb8abc6397c86531562a6df6cdcca2409ef SHA512 abb01cb66e413d47786b836f6fc74355fe788a4ae19b152bceecf15cac2eebcfb5c596c469042eff01028a75e467149ce4a2fa431e3e393c453d8bf6c787c697 WHIRLPOOL c571035d1a71b626bc7bd391e658cdfbe771363b6b215bdcd9022456889eae612c249d68a295b594eeacede67ff0d0ad058076cfb4e21f25230f57b62ce612c3
+MISC ChangeLog 11481 SHA256 02187cbef980690c8cb4fa894c59d6bf3821cf9f90f396822b8b9b7116ca2dcf SHA512 b6b2bcb6095cc66cef56fe2fa828a9d25de4d021f9d8f9ab6d78e3ff453230e7889f08daf33a36e29f013d1087f52a8f0da061fccd7dc0d99c816a9633c4be3c WHIRLPOOL 6a77263dd7e423b1e1a61d29269899d6754f7388ee8351e3e964085ebc6f74a49832ceaaf8d271bc40928c7463c53515c436f166d1be454a955ad06b8f331d20
+MISC metadata.xml 470 SHA256 3eae9a7016c60861699f996a9f4e1ae2e68bae5d3b79594a10034a22c8b7b2d4 SHA512 745a6b1480616cb53d5ea9b6535e058e459853828376fdfdcaf16dbeab4e7ecee9ba4608f317fe628588a7be9567e0bbcc5b457d4b306a3180c9f18db0b6f04d WHIRLPOOL dc6c6fb6671d884582d1d56ab948c5970566e57f86e8d9c91bfeb25d4ec94597289abf750d54bbdf9c2b32ef33f1e856783ccdc34bb3a889c640af6ed8c117fb
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.19 (GNU/Linux)
-iEYEAREIAAYFAlChsxMACgkQakKUmsHeVLJ7rgCeJQmZzpEZkNxvqdjymDx6WEVz
-IT4An2CzyVxjDUSmDJM30nXdgndChkt5
-=nwmQ
+iEYEAREIAAYFAlDZuU0ACgkQCaWpQKGI+9SbZQCfXH6qGgdfdJeqIvmgUPeV4vCz
+B1AAni2V4CI+QhlYqmdMqNHpy4mZJyGL
+=5IQZ
-----END PGP SIGNATURE-----
diff --git a/www-apps/viewvc/metadata.xml b/www-apps/viewvc/metadata.xml
index e119196be6c7..15664488ccee 100644
--- a/www-apps/viewvc/metadata.xml
+++ b/www-apps/viewvc/metadata.xml
@@ -4,7 +4,6 @@
<herd>web-apps</herd>
<use>
<flag name="cvsgraph">Add <pkg>dev-vcs/cvsgraph</pkg> support to show graphical views of revisions and branches</flag>
- <flag name="mod_python">Add <pkg>www-apache/mod_python</pkg> support</flag>
<flag name="mod_wsgi">Add <pkg>www-apache/mod_wsgi</pkg> support</flag>
<flag name="pygments">Add <pkg>dev-python/pygments</pkg> support for syntax highlighting</flag>
</use>
diff --git a/www-apps/viewvc/viewvc-1.1.13.ebuild b/www-apps/viewvc/viewvc-1.1.13.ebuild
deleted file mode 100644
index b912294dc067..000000000000
--- a/www-apps/viewvc/viewvc-1.1.13.ebuild
+++ /dev/null
@@ -1,118 +0,0 @@
-# Copyright 1999-2012 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/www-apps/viewvc/viewvc-1.1.13.ebuild,v 1.2 2012/05/21 21:34:16 darkside Exp $
-
-EAPI="3"
-PYTHON_DEPEND="2"
-SUPPORT_PYTHON_ABIS="1"
-RESTRICT_PYTHON_ABIS="3.* *-jython"
-
-inherit confutils eutils python webapp
-
-WEBAPP_MANUAL_SLOT="yes"
-
-DESCRIPTION="ViewVC, a web interface to CVS and Subversion"
-HOMEPAGE="http://viewvc.org/"
-DOWNLOAD_NUMBER="49161"
-SRC_URI="http://viewvc.tigris.org/files/documents/3330/${DOWNLOAD_NUMBER}/${P}.tar.gz"
-
-LICENSE="BSD-2"
-SLOT="0"
-KEYWORDS="amd64 ~ppc x86"
-IUSE="cvs cvsgraph mod_python mod_wsgi mysql pygments +subversion"
-
-DEPEND=""
-RDEPEND="
- cvs? ( dev-vcs/rcs )
- subversion? ( >=dev-vcs/subversion-1.3.1[python] )
-
- mod_python? ( www-apache/mod_python )
- mod_wsgi? ( www-apache/mod_wsgi )
- !mod_python? ( !mod_wsgi? ( virtual/httpd-cgi ) )
-
- cvsgraph? ( >=dev-vcs/cvsgraph-1.5.0 )
- mysql? ( >=dev-python/mysql-python-0.9.0 )
- pygments? (
- dev-python/pygments
- app-misc/mime-types
- )
-"
-
-pkg_setup() {
- python_pkg_setup
- webapp_pkg_setup
-
- confutils_require_any cvs subversion
-}
-
-src_prepare() {
- find bin/ -type f -print0 | xargs -0 sed -i \
- -e "s|\(^LIBRARY_DIR\)\(.*\$\)|\1 = \"$(python_get_sitedir -f)/${PN}\"|g" \
- -e "s|\(^CONF_PATHNAME\)\(.*\$\)|\1 = \"../conf/viewvc.conf\"|g"
-
- sed -i -e "s|\(self\.options\.template_dir\)\(.*\$\)|\1 = \"${MY_APPDIR}/templates\"|" \
- lib/config.py
-
- sed -i -e "s|^template_dir.*|#&|" conf/viewvc.conf.dist
- sed -i -e "s|^#mime_types_files =.*|mime_types_files = /etc/mime.types|" conf/viewvc.conf.dist
- mv conf/viewvc.conf{.dist,}
- mv conf/cvsgraph.conf{.dist,}
-
- python_convert_shebangs -r 2 .
-}
-
-src_install() {
- webapp_src_preinst
-
- newbin bin/standalone.py viewvc-standalone-server || die "newbin failed"
-
- dodoc CHANGES COMMITTERS INSTALL README || die "dodoc failed"
-
- installation() {
- insinto $(python_get_sitedir)/${PN}
- doins -r lib/*
- }
- python_execute_function installation
-
- insinto "${MY_APPDIR}"
- doins -r templates/ || die "doins failed"
- doins -r templates-contrib/ || die "doins failed"
-
- if use mysql; then
- exeinto "${MY_HOSTROOTDIR}/bin"
- doexe bin/{*dbadmin,make-database,loginfo-handler} || die "doexe failed"
- fi
-
- insinto "${MY_HOSTROOTDIR}/conf"
- doins conf/{viewvc,cvsgraph}.conf
-
- if use mod_python; then
- insinto "${MY_HTDOCSDIR}"
- doins bin/mod_python/viewvc.py || die "doins failed"
- doins bin/mod_python/handler.py || die "doins failed"
- doins bin/mod_python/.htaccess || die "doins failed"
- if use mysql; then
- doins bin/mod_python/query.py || die "doins failed"
- fi
- else
- exeinto "${MY_CGIBINDIR}"
- doexe bin/cgi/viewvc.cgi || die "doexe failed"
- if use mysql; then
- doexe bin/cgi/query.cgi || die "doexe failed"
- fi
- fi
-
- webapp_configfile "${MY_HOSTROOTDIR}/conf/"{viewvc,cvsgraph}.conf
-
- webapp_src_install
-}
-
-pkg_postinst() {
- python_mod_optimize viewvc
- webapp_pkg_postinst
- elog "Now read INSTALL in /usr/share/doc/${PF} to configure ${PN}"
-}
-
-pkg_postrm() {
- python_mod_cleanup viewvc
-}
diff --git a/www-apps/viewvc/viewvc-1.1.17.ebuild b/www-apps/viewvc/viewvc-1.1.17.ebuild
index d6dd32d2427c..d69009a7d1c4 100644
--- a/www-apps/viewvc/viewvc-1.1.17.ebuild
+++ b/www-apps/viewvc/viewvc-1.1.17.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2012 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/www-apps/viewvc/viewvc-1.1.17.ebuild,v 1.3 2012/11/12 18:46:50 nativemad Exp $
+# $Header: /var/cvsroot/gentoo-x86/www-apps/viewvc/viewvc-1.1.17.ebuild,v 1.4 2012/12/25 14:33:47 pacho Exp $
EAPI="3"
PYTHON_DEPEND="2"
@@ -19,16 +19,15 @@ SRC_URI="http://viewvc.tigris.org/files/documents/3330/${DOWNLOAD_NUMBER}/${P}.t
LICENSE="BSD-2"
SLOT="0"
KEYWORDS="amd64 ~ppc x86"
-IUSE="cvs cvsgraph mod_python mod_wsgi mysql pygments +subversion"
+IUSE="cvs cvsgraph mod_wsgi mysql pygments +subversion"
DEPEND=""
RDEPEND="
cvs? ( dev-vcs/rcs )
subversion? ( >=dev-vcs/subversion-1.3.1[python] )
- mod_python? ( www-apache/mod_python )
mod_wsgi? ( www-apache/mod_wsgi )
- !mod_python? ( !mod_wsgi? ( virtual/httpd-cgi ) )
+ !mod_wsgi? ( virtual/httpd-cgi )
cvsgraph? ( >=dev-vcs/cvsgraph-1.5.0 )
mysql? ( >=dev-python/mysql-python-0.9.0 )
@@ -86,20 +85,10 @@ src_install() {
insinto "${MY_HOSTROOTDIR}/conf"
doins conf/{viewvc,cvsgraph}.conf
- if use mod_python; then
- insinto "${MY_HTDOCSDIR}"
- doins bin/mod_python/viewvc.py || die "doins failed"
- doins bin/mod_python/handler.py || die "doins failed"
- doins bin/mod_python/.htaccess || die "doins failed"
- if use mysql; then
- doins bin/mod_python/query.py || die "doins failed"
- fi
- else
- exeinto "${MY_CGIBINDIR}"
- doexe bin/cgi/viewvc.cgi || die "doexe failed"
- if use mysql; then
- doexe bin/cgi/query.cgi || die "doexe failed"
- fi
+ exeinto "${MY_CGIBINDIR}"
+ doexe bin/cgi/viewvc.cgi || die "doexe failed"
+ if use mysql; then
+ doexe bin/cgi/query.cgi || die "doexe failed"
fi
webapp_configfile "${MY_HOSTROOTDIR}/conf/"{viewvc,cvsgraph}.conf